Given 30% while driving a Honda Fit (Jazz) (175/65 R14 T) on mostly country roads for 4,000 easy going miles
These came on my mum's Honda Jazz. They are notable for being the worst tires I have ever experienced with respect to braking and traction in the wet or damp. The braking distances were huge and the ABS triggered at absurdly low pedal pressure. I checked out the brakes but all was good. The problem was sorted when I got Yokohama Blu Earth tires fitted instead.

These tires are proof there are no decent controls on tires (E certification is meaningless) and that there is no short supply of fools who rejoice in saving a few pennies even if they later lose their lives due to the junk they buy.
Why do people spend thousands on cars then ruin them and negate safety features with cheap crap tires?

Never, ever fit Event tires. (A friend has similarly dangerous ones on his Vectra).

Given 50% while driving a Mazda Demio 1.3L 2002 (175/70 R13 T) on mostly country roads for 30,000 average miles
Did not test to limit of adhesion dry or wet, but no noticeable performance deficiency. Very poor wear though, greatly inferior to Roadstone(Nexen) SB702. Noise level OK except on New Zealand chip seal.
